Problem
Hybrid braided medical devices experience unintentional rotation during delivery, leading to potential detachment or binding issues due to helical bias, which can cause deformation and failure of the device and delivery member.
Innovation Solution
A neutral hybrid braided pattern is created by alternating the direction of wire crossings (CW and CCW) to counteract rotational forces, minimizing device rotation and ensuring secure deployment.

Data Source
AI summary
A method for making a neutral hybrid braided structure may involve positioning a first set of wires on a braiding machine in a first set of positions, positioning a second set of wires on the braiding machine in a second set of positions so that the first set of positions and the second set of positions form a neutral hybrid braiding pattern, and braiding the first set of wires and the second set of wires on the braiding machine to form the neutral hybrid braided structure. Each wire in the first set of wires has a first cross-sectional diameter, and each wire in the second set of wires has a second cross-sectional diameter that is smaller than the first cross-sectional diameter.
